Transaction 8a384c0b23a46845e91493ccba507de69f9188ece5df732bcaf7b82bbcc44f57
1 Input
1 Output
-
8a384c0b23a46845e91493ccba507de69f9188ece5df732bcaf7b82bbcc44f57:0
- value
- 512654
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 74b588cc6e3c3e37cbf76acf4164da358d40476d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Be6rUvZ6nNfDM5KkWG8Wq9MSmWU5f6GjK